Step 1 — Find the Right Pinterest Video to Repurpose
Not every Pinterest video is worth repurposing. Follow these tips to pick winners:
- Look for high saves and engagement — Pins with thousands of saves signal content that resonates.
- Choose vertical videos (9:16 ratio) — These are already optimized for Instagram Reels and TikTok.
- Pick niche-specific content — Travel, fitness, beauty, cooking, fashion, and home décor perform best on both Reels and TikTok.
- Avoid heavily branded videos — Skip content with another brand's visible watermark or logo.
- Check video length — Aim for videos between 15–60 seconds for best performance on Reels and TikTok.

Step 3 — Edit the Video for Instagram Reels & TikTok
Raw Pinterest videos usually need a few tweaks before they're ready for Reels or TikTok. Here's what to do:
Trim & Crop
Most Pinterest videos are already short, but trim any dead space at the start or end. Ensure the aspect ratio is 9:16 (vertical) — the native format for both Instagram Reels and TikTok. Use free tools like CapCut, InShot, or VN Video Editor on mobile, or DaVinci Resolve on desktop.
Add Your Branding
Overlay your logo, username, or a simple text watermark. This is crucial — it marks the content as part of your page and makes it traceable back to you even if re-shared.
Add Captions & Text
Both TikTok and Instagram Reels auto-generate captions, but adding your own custom text overlay increases watch time by up to 40%. Add a hook in the first 2 seconds — something like "Wait for it..." or "This changed everything for me."
Add Trending Audio
Replace or layer trending audio on top of the original video. Instagram Reels and TikTok heavily boost content using trending sounds. Check TikTok's "Trending" sounds section or Instagram's Reels audio explorer before uploading.
Write a Strong Caption
Write a caption that adds context, asks a question, or encourages saves. For example: "Save this for your next home décor project! 🏡 Which room would you try this in?"
Step 4 — Upload to Instagram Reels
Follow these best practices when posting your repurposed Pinterest video as an Instagram Reel:
- Video length: 15–90 seconds performs best. Keep it under 30 seconds for maximum reach.
- Resolution: 1080 x 1920px (9:16). SavePin downloads in this resolution — no resizing needed.
- Cover image: Choose a visually striking frame as your Reel cover to attract clicks.
- Hashtags: Use 3–5 niche hashtags. Avoid stuffing — Instagram's algorithm deprioritizes over-hashtagged posts.
- Post timing: Tuesday–Friday between 9am–12pm and 7pm–9pm in your audience's timezone.
- Add a CTA: End the caption with a call-to-action: "Save this post!", "Follow for more!", or "Tag a friend who needs this."
Step 5 — Upload to TikTok
TikTok has its own best practices. Here's how to optimize your repurposed Pinterest video for TikTok:
- Hook in the first 1–2 seconds: TikTok users scroll fast. Lead with your most visually interesting or surprising moment.
- Video length: 21–34 seconds is the sweet spot for TikTok watch-time completion rates.
- Use TikTok's native editor: Upload your video and add effects, stickers, and text inside TikTok's app — it signals native content and can boost distribution.
- Trending sounds: Always check TikTok's trending audio before posting. Content with trending sounds gets 3–5x more reach.
- Hashtags: Use a mix of niche hashtags (#homedecor, #aestheticroom) and broad ones (#foryou, #viral). Aim for 4–6 total.
- Post frequency: TikTok rewards consistent posting. Aim for 1–3 videos per day when starting out.

Content Ideas: What Pinterest Videos Work Best on Reels & TikTok?
| Pinterest Niche | Best Platform | Content Type |
|---|---|---|
| Home Décor & Interior Design | Instagram Reels | Before/after transformations, aesthetic room tours |
| Recipes & Cooking | Both | Quick recipe clips, 60-second meal preps |
| Fashion & Outfits | Both | Outfit inspo, style tips, GRWM videos |
| Fitness & Workouts | TikTok | Quick workout routines, motivation clips |
| Travel & Destinations | Instagram Reels | Scenic b-roll, destination highlights |
| DIY & Crafts | Both | Tutorial clips, satisfying process videos |
| Skincare & Beauty | TikTok | Product demos, skincare routines, transformations |
| Motivational & Aesthetic | Instagram Reels | Mood aesthetic videos, quote overlays |
Important: Copyright & Ethical Use
Before repurposing any Pinterest video, keep these points in mind:
- Always credit the original creator when possible — tag them in your caption or video.
- Do not claim the content as your own — be transparent that it's curated content.
- Never use branded or trademarked content without permission.
- Check for Creative Commons or royalty-free licenses when repurposing for commercial use.
- Repurposing for personal, educational, or transformative commentary is generally acceptable under fair use — but always use good judgement.
